CPDQC5V0CSP-IPHF Equivalent & Substitute Parts

Part Overview

The CPDQC5V0CSP-IPHF is a Transient Voltage Suppressor (TVS) diode manufactured by Comchip Technology, designed for general-purpose overvoltage protection applications. This component features a 5V reverse standoff voltage with an 18V maximum clamping voltage and 2A peak pulse current rating in a compact 0402 surface mount package.

The CPDQC5V0CSP-IPHF is classified as obsolete. Identifying equivalent and substitute parts is necessary to ensure continued availability for new designs, production continuity, and long-term component sourcing strategies.

Substitute Part Grouping Explanation

Substitution of the CPDQC5V0CSP-IPHF is determined by strict equivalence across the following critical parameters:

  • Voltage - Reverse Standoff (Typ): 5V (Max)
  • Voltage - Clamping (Max) @ Ipp: 18V
  • Current - Peak Pulse (10/1000µs): 2A (8/20µs)
  • Package / Case: 0402 (1006 Metric)
  • Mounting Type: Surface Mount
  • Operating Temperature Range: -55°C ~ 150°C (TJ)
  • RoHS Compliance: ROHS3 Compliant

The CPDQC5V0SC-HF meets all substitution criteria. Both parts share identical voltage ratings, current handling capacity, package specifications, temperature range, and regulatory compliance. Minor variations in voltage breakdown minimum (7V vs. 6V) and capacitance (0.15pF vs. 0.2pF) remain within acceptable tolerance for general-purpose TVS applications and do not affect functional equivalence.

Engineering Selection Recommendations

The CPDQC5V0SC-HF is the direct substitute for the obsolete CPDQC5V0CSP-IPHF. Both components are manufactured by Comchip Technology and maintain identical electrical and mechanical specifications across all critical parameters. The substitute part carries Active product status, ensuring long-term availability and production support.

Both parts maintain ROHS3 compliance and Moisture Sensitivity Level 1 (Unlimited), meeting regulatory and environmental requirements for industrial and commercial applications.
